vba读取csv文件到excel_利用VBA读取文件中任意字符数的方法

大家好,疫情施虐,国外各地更有爆发的迹象,但无论怎样,我们一定要坚信,疫情终将会过去,曙光一定会到来。后疫情时代将会是一个全新的世界,很多理念都将被打破,大多数人不会再享受体制内的保护,对于我们每个人,要尽可能多的学习有用的知识,为自己充电。在今后更加严峻的存量残杀世界中,为自己的生存进行知识的储备,特别是新知识的储备。为后疫情时代做的必要准备。

今日继续和大家分享VBA编程中常用的常用"积木"过程代码。这些内容大多是我的经验和记录,来源于我多年的经验。今日分享的是NO.240,内容是:

NO. 240:从顺序文件中读取任意字符数和读取整个文件的方法

4ea036af8e6ac3f10feeff2534a9e5b7.png

VBA过程代码240:从顺序文件中读取任意字符数和读取整个文件的方法

Sub Mynz()

Dim num As Integer

Dim zhang As String

num = 0

Open "E:视频VBA代码解决方案第三册人员表单.txt" For Input As #1

Do While Not EOF(1)

zhang = Input(1, #1)

If zhang = "张" Then

num = num + 1

End If

Loop

If num <> 0 Then

MsgBox "表单中姓张的共: " & num & "人!"

Else

MsgBox "没有姓张的人员."

End If

Close #1

End Sub

f196d7a62d6eff43afbad4a224077ff7.png

代码解析:Mynz过程中Input函数允许你返回顺序文件中的任何字符。如果你使用VBA函数LOF作为Input函数的第一个参数时,你将能够快速地读取顺序文件里的所有内容,而不需要在整个文件上循环。备注:LOF函数返回一个文件上的所有字节数。LOF是Length of File的缩写。

VBA是利用OFFICE实现自己小型办公自动化的有效手段,我根据自己20多年的VBA实际利用经验,现在推出了四部VBA经验学习资料,是我"积木编程"思想的体现。

第一:VBA代码解决方案,是VBA中各个知识点的讲解,覆盖了绝大多数的知识点;

第二:VBA数据库解决方案,是数据处理的专业利器,介绍利用ADO连接ACCDB,EXCEL。

第三:VBA数组与字典解决方案,讲解VBA中的数组和字典的利用。

第四:VBA代码解决方案之视频,是专门面向初学者的视频讲解,可以快速入门,更快的掌握这门技能。

348ee42f6b652bf17f5d7517e67fe3d9.png

目前正在写第五部教程:VBA中类的解读和利用,希望在年内陆续在各个平台和大家见面。

VBA真的非常实用,希望大家掌握这个工具,利用这个工具,让自己在工作中轻松,高效,快乐。学习有用的知识,让健康的知识服务于大众,不要想不劳而获,更不要去偷奸取巧,踏踏实实,沉下心,提高自己,为后疫情时代做好知识的储备。

评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值